If your dog has diarrhea and it doesn’t clear up in a few days, gets frequent bouts of diarrhea, or looks or acts sick, take it to the vet. The vet should be able to find the cause of the diarrhea and will usually prescribe anti-diarrheal medications such as metronidazole.
